Magnus Carlsen is a Norwegian chess grandmaster, widely regarded as the greatest player in the history of the sport. He won the World Chess Championship title in 2013 and defended it for a decade, in addition to dominating the rapid and blitz chess formats. He achieved the highest rating in FIDE history, cementing his status as a phenomenon who transcended the limits of the board.
